技术文摘
熟练掌握常见CSS属性选择器的运用
熟练掌握常见 CSS 属性选择器的运用
在网页设计与开发领域,CSS(层叠样式表)起着至关重要的作用。而属性选择器作为 CSS 中强大的工具之一,能够帮助开发者更加精准地选择和样式化 HTML 元素。熟练掌握常见 CSS 属性选择器的运用,能显著提升开发效率和页面效果。
首先是最基础的[属性]选择器。它的语法简单直接,例如:a[href],这表示选择所有带有 href 属性的 <a> 标签元素。通过这个选择器,我们可以轻松地为所有链接添加统一的样式,比如改变链接的颜色、字体等。这种基本的属性选择器在为具有特定属性的元素设置通用样式时非常实用。
进一步深入,[属性=值]选择器则更加精确。假设我们有这样的需求:为页面中 type 属性值为 submit 的按钮添加特殊样式。此时,input[type="submit"] 这个选择器就能派上用场,我们可以通过它来定义提交按钮独特的外观,如背景色、边框等,让提交按钮在页面中更加突出,提升用户交互体验。
对于属性值包含特定单词的情况,[属性=值]选择器就发挥作用了。例如,在一个包含多个类名的元素中,我们想找到类名中包含 “special” 这个单词的元素,可以使用 `div[class="special"]`。这种选择器在处理复杂的类名结构时非常灵活,能够满足多样化的样式需求。
还有[属性^=值]选择器和[属性$=值]选择器。前者用于选择属性值以指定值开头的元素,比如 a[href^="https"],可以选中所有以 “https” 开头的链接,便于对安全链接进行特殊样式设置;后者则选择属性值以指定值结尾的元素,像 img[src$=".jpg"],能快速定位所有以 “.jpg” 结尾的图片元素,对图片样式进行统一管理。
熟练掌握这些常见的 CSS 属性选择器,不仅能让代码更加简洁高效,还能在面对复杂的页面布局和多样化的样式需求时游刃有余。无论是优化现有页面的样式,还是开发全新的项目,精准运用属性选择器都能为开发者节省大量时间和精力,打造出更加美观、易用的网页。
TAGS: CSS属性选择器 常见CSS属性选择器 CSS属性选择器运用
- Win11 隐藏桌面图标的方法
- Win11 分盘方法:电脑 C 磁盘如何操作
- 方正 UEFI 启动 U 盘安装 Win8 系统指南
- 索尼 ea300c 笔记本 win10 系统安装教程
- 如何关闭 Linux 系统中不用的进程
- 如何设置 Linux 系统终端透明
- Win10 语音包的安装方法及系统启用新语音包技巧
- Win11 资源管理器停止工作的解决方法与修复教程
- Win10 22H2 首个预览版 19045.1865 推送至 Release 频道用户
- Win11 语音添加方法及新语音包添加技巧
- Ubuntu 16.04 中文版安装基础入门图文教程
- Linux 系统录屏方法及相关软件使用教程
- Linux 系统中网页版钉钉加密消息无法查看的解决方法
- Win10 鼠标右键持续转圈的解决之道
- VMware 虚拟机中 Ubuntu 16.04 安装详细教程(含图文及下载地址)